Ginger Halibut with Shredded Daikon Radish
 
Ingredients:
2 8-ounce halibut fillets
1 tablespoon tamari
1 tablespoon sesame oil
1 teaspoon fresh ginger juice
1/2 cup water
1 tablespoon olive oil

1 cup daikon radish, shredded
 

Directions:

  1. Wash fish and place in a shallow baking dish.

  2. Mix tamari, sesame oil, ginger juice and water in a small bowl.

  3. Cover fish with marinade and refrigerate for 20-30 minutes.

  4. Heat olive oil in a pan.

  5. Add fish and cook for about 7 minutes until fish is almost done.

  6. Add remaining marinade and cook until fish is completely cooked and marinade is heated.

  7. Serve with shredded daikon radish.


Notes:

 

Prep time:
5 minutes

Cooking time:
30 minutes

Yields:
2 people
